This is a single cultivar wine, best of its kind, made from only top-notch Chenin Blanc grapes. The fruit was harvested later in season, when natural sugars are concentrated in the fruit. So, no sugar is added. It is bottled at 11,2% alcohol.

Skyline Late Harvest is a fine balance of sweetness and acidity, so a classic match with rich liver pate or parfait. It’s great with desserts too. Try serving it with cheesecake, crème caramel or baked custard; fruit-based desserts such as apricot and peach tarts and glazed fruit tartlets or pavlova.
